Junior League of Washington Names First African-American President-Elect

The Junior League of Washington welcomes its 2017-2018 Board of Directors, the team of women who will lead the charitable, educational organization throughout its 105th anniversary year. The newly elected Board of Directors includes Tycely Williams, who will serve as President-Elect in 2017-2018 before assuming the role of President in 2018-2019, the first African-American and woman of color to serve in these roles in the League’s history.

Washington Middle School for Girls, Grant Recipient

The Junior League of Washington is proud to announce a grant of $25,000 to the Washington Middle School for Girls. Founded in 1997, WMSG is dedicated to providing a good education and other forms of support for girls in an under-served area of Washington, DC.
